I may have found a thing that could cause it, it seems to add up. A few weeks ago I disasembled the throttle cable bit next to the carb. Well I may have put it back together wrong, you see i put the needle on top of the gold piece instead of underneath, so this would mean the needle could stick up when the slide is down causing problems. I hope this is the problem as it is a nice cheap fix :thumbup:
